Home of the Hawks, PRE offers full-day FREE kindergarten, before and after school care, gifted and special education, full-time Master level school counselor, health services, music, arts, physical education, and more.
The Arizona Department of Education has released A-F School Letter Grades scores based on data from the 2023-24 school year and Picture Rocks Elementary School received an A Letter Grade.
Collaborative partnerships allow our school to leverage family, school, and community resources to remove barriers to learning and provide essentials to families in need.
Licensed by the AZ Dept. of Health Services, and AZ Dept. of Economic Security approved, our school offers preschool with small/large group activities and enrichment learning activities that promote development in the arts and large motor skills.
Picture Rocks offers a wide variety of academic learning for students, including Gifted Education in Marana (GEM) services, co-taught classes for math and ELA to support students with special needs, exceptional student services programming, english learner programming, and Title I support.
Picture Rocks Elementary is pleased to announce the achievement of Level 1 certification in Marzano High-Reliability Schools™. Level 1 certification means our school has created a “Safe, Supportive, and Collaborative Culture,” which is the foundation for every level that follows.
